WebThe scapholunate ligament is an important ligament that holds the scaphoid and lunate bones together. When ruptured it can cause pain and instability in the wrist in short term and degenerative arthritis in 5-10 years. The injury often results from a fall onto the outstretched hand or a forceful/violent twisting injury to the hand. WebScaphoid fractures are a type of broken wrist. WebJan 2, 2024 · Scapholunate-friendly strengthening muscles are those that pull the scaphoid into supination and stabilize the SL joint. These include the ECRL, wrist extension and radial deviation, FCU-wrist flexion and ulnar deviation, APL-thumb abduction. The FCR muscle can be a friendly and unfriendly carpal stabilizer, depending on the stage of SL injury.
